Well my stock Advan Sports gave it up after 11k, so it was time for some new rubber. I was looking at Conti DW's but after reading about sidewall flex I went with some PSS in stock 18" sizes. The price was right at $800, installed with rebate. I had no problems with the Advans. I thought it was a great tire except for wet weather performance. The PSS are truly a performance upgrade. Less road noise, fantastic wet and dry, less tramlining, more stable at speed in corners! Amazing street tire! Let's see how long they last.
